## Capacity note: Ledgerline ORM refactor

Reviewer: the refactor replaces per-row hydration with batched fetches, so connection-pool pressure shifts from many short queries to fewer long ones. I sized pools against peak traffic from the Harvale cluster, assuming 30% headroom. Please check the batch and pool constants carefully; they are as follows.

tuning table, fawip-fahag:
WEIGHTS = {
    "novwyn": 452,
    "casdor": 675,
}

Subject: Handover — Lumenfork release duties

Hey Priya,

Welcome aboard! Quick note before I'm out: the Lumenfork serverless handlers get cold-start spikes every Monday after the weekend scale-down, so we pre-warm them via the warmup job in the release pipeline. Don't skip it or latency alerts will page you all morning. Everything else is in the runbook. When you push the warmup bundle, it has to be signed. Here's the deploy key you'll need for that:

rollout seal: bky4_x7Gc

TICKET — Missed Contract Run

Hey, the courier never showed for the signed contracts going from our Fennick Row office to the Marwood branch yesterday. Legal's getting antsy since countersignatures are due. Can you slot a rerun first thing tomorrow? Envelopes are sealed and waiting at reception. Give the driver this hand-over instruction:

handover note for yagef-bagep: the drudor pelius courier leaves the kasdor zorvan norir ledger at gate 8016 under passcode 755406

Handover — Dara to Molloy, facilities desk. Orvex door sensors on floors 2–4 are under recall. Vendor collects units Thursday AM. Tag each removed sensor, log location, leave doors on manual latch. Do not reinstall spares from the basement stock — same batch. Recall crate is in the secure store; entry needs the code below.

staff pass of kawep-hahap = bdg-IEUUF-6

**Ticket QRV-2291: Enable monthly partitioning on shipments table**

Requesting migration of the Corvane shipments table to range partitions keyed by created_month. Plan includes a dual-write window, backfill of 18 months of history, and a verification pass comparing row counts per partition. Rollback script is attached and has been rehearsed in the Mellis staging cluster. Release manager: this change ships only after written sign-off from the person named below.

account owner for bawip-tahag: Raleth Quenok